### Step 4: Register the shard-router with ProfileVault

Before cutting traffic to the new shards, register the shard-router instance with the ProfileVault control plane. Verify that all eight shard replicas report healthy and that the rebalance queue is empty — proceeding otherwise risks split writes to user-profile records. Record the registration timestamp in the migration log. Authentication to the control plane requires the internal API key issued for this runbook, shown below.

service key, fawip-bajef: kto11_Qt5wZK9vdNC

Minutes — Management Meeting, Ordale Fabrication Group

The committee reviewed staffing in the Coilworks Division and approved a hiring freeze effective immediately, covering all open requisitions except safety-critical roles. Finance will model payroll savings through year-end; Henrik Valsted owns the tracker. Exceptions require dual sign-off. Review in eight weeks. The confidential planning note for finance appears below.

internal memo for hafog-hadug: The pricing group signed off on a budget of $16.1 million for Project Gorir. The renewal with Oliionax Systems closes at $14.1 million a year, 46 percent above the last contract.

TICKET: Needs sign-off — resizr-batch CLI v0.9

Batch image resizing CLI for the Murkwood pipeline is ready. Changes: parallel worker pool capped at 8, EXIF stripping now default, new --fit flag. On-call: do not deploy until sign-off lands. Known issue: progress bar flickers under tmux; cosmetic only. Rollback is a single binary swap. Smoke tests pass on staging. Sign-off must come from the engineer below.

named custodian: Brivan Eliath Quenox Frador